The Houston Rockets will square off with the Los Angeles Lakers in Game 3 of their 2026 NBA Playoffs series at Toyota Center on Friday, starting at 8:00 PM ET.

Based on the latest simulation results and today’s injury reports, Dimers' proven NBA model predicts the Rockets as the most likely winner of the Lakers vs. Rockets Game 3 matchup.

This prediction follows the latest NBA Injury Report, which suggests the Rockets lineup will feature players like Alperen Sengun, Amen Thompson and Jabari Smith, while the Lakers will look to LeBron James, Luke Kennard and Rui Hachimura.

Luka Doncic will not be on the court, with the Slovenian star out for this one.

Lakers vs. Rockets prediction: Who will win Game 3?

Using powerful machine learning and data, we have simulated the outcome of Friday's NBA Playoffs game between the Lakers and Rockets, forming part of our NBA predictions coverage.

Our independent predictive model gives the Rockets a 72% chance of defeating the Lakers in Game 3 of the series. Our predicted final score has the Rockets winning 106-99.

According to our model, the Rockets (-7.5) have a 53% chance of covering the spread, while the over/under total of 206.5 points has a 51% chance of going over.

Lakers vs. Rockets Game 3 updates and essential details

Friday's Game 3 between the Rockets and Lakers in the NBA Playoffs is scheduled to start at 8:00 PM ET.

The NBA Playoffs is an annual elimination tournament held to determine the league's champion.

Sixteen teams, including the Lakers and Rockets, reached the NBA Playoffs 2026, which consists of four rounds: the First Round, Conference Semifinals, Conference Finals, and NBA Finals.

Each round is played as a best-of-seven series, with the first team to four wins progressing to the next round until a champion is crowned.
